Output 5eb4f8b9dfb7e3e81a2418145ff403eaa9f6a81bfc184f0ff4bda6b8e768dbb6:20

value
899233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d889b44e29c1a7723bb74ea605137efcb74441 OP_EQUAL
address
32DvhpYMFX4ebEbPgxrYTEikfQkMwiTi7X
transaction
5eb4f8b9dfb7e3e81a2418145ff403eaa9f6a81bfc184f0ff4bda6b8e768dbb6
confirmations
371870
spent
true